Web14 aug. 2024 · In his poem “Meeting at Night,” Robert Browning uses personification to exaggerate the romantic mood of his poem. By mentioning the “startled little waves” and their “fiery ringlets,” he projects the speaker’s excitement about his situation onto the setting of the poem (Browning, 1845). Web28 jul. 2024 · The poem is about a meeting at night of two Lovers. The poem has several descriptions of night. It open with a description of the grey sea. Grey sea, Long black land, Yellow half moon all play a significant role to set the mood of the poem and to paint a landscape. The word "black" stands for darkness and night.

Although by the poem's end the purpose of the journey is made clear to the reader, the speaker does not explain where he is going or why and never gives any … eight thousand nine hundred and twelveWeb30 aug. 2024 · Ans: The poem “Meeting at Night” by Robert Browning is full of imagery. Every line of the poem centres about an image. The ‘grey sea’, ‘long black land’, ‘the yellow moon’, ‘startled little waves’ are examples of some visual images.
